New Covid-19 vaccine booster shots were approved, but likely for a more limited number of people
The FDA has approved new Covid-19 vaccine booster shots from Pfizer, Moderna, and Novavax, but these will be available for a more limited group of people.

One brother approved, one denied for same gene therapy
NegativeHealth
Two brothers with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y face a stark contrast in their treatment options. One brother received insurance approval for a promising gene therapy, while the other was denied coverage for the same treatment. This disparity highlights the challenges families face in accessing necessary medical care.
